Description
Technical field
The present invention relates to bending machine assembled component, particularly a kind of automatic centering structure.
Background technology
Bending machine roughly can be divided into CNC tube bending machine, hydraulic pipe bender etc.Be mainly used in power construction, public railway construction, boiler, bridge, boats and ships, furniture, the pipe laying of the aspects such as decoration and building, have that function is many, rational in infrastructure, simple operation and other advantages.In actual production process, bend pipe mostly is middle part bend pipe, when bend pipe, as inaccurate in centering position, then easily produce defect ware, and the centering step now in bend pipe process mostly is and adopts people for centering, when people is centering, chi, setting-out need be drawn, not only centering inefficiency, and the degree of accuracy is poor, waste time and energy.
Summary of the invention
For the problems referred to above, the present invention proposes a kind of automatic centering structure.
For solving above technical problem, technical scheme provided by the invention is:
A kind of automatic centering structure, it is characterized in that, described automatic centering structure comprises centering transaxle, be positioned at the left centering rod of centering transaxle both sides and right centering rod, the axis of described left centering rod and the axis of right centering rod are same straight line, the right-hand member of described left centering rod is fixed with left tooth bar, described left tooth bar is L-shaped, the left end of right centering rod is fixed with right tooth bar, described right tooth bar is L-shaped, described centering transaxle is between left tooth bar and right tooth bar, comprise shell, described shell is rectangular, rotating shaft is provided with in it, the two ends up and down of described rotating shaft are provided with bearing, the middle-end of rotating shaft is sheathed with gear, left centering rod and right centering rod penetrate in housing, left tooth bar and right tooth bar are positioned at housing, the tooth mouth corresponding matching of described gear and left tooth bar and right tooth bar.

Detailed description of the invention
A kind of automatic centering structure, it is characterized in that, described automatic centering structure 1 draws together centering transaxle 2, be positioned at left centering rod 3 and the right centering rod 4 of centering transaxle 2 both sides, the axis of described left centering rod 3 and the axis of right centering rod 4 are same straight line, the right-hand member of described left centering rod 3 is fixed with left tooth bar 5, described left tooth bar 5 is L-shaped, the left end of right centering rod 4 is fixed with right tooth bar 6, described right tooth bar 6 is L-shaped, described centering transaxle 2 is between left tooth bar 5 and right tooth bar 6, comprise shell 7, described shell 7 is rectangular, rotating shaft 8 is provided with in it, the two ends up and down of described rotating shaft 8 are provided with bearing 9, the middle-end of rotating shaft 8 is sheathed with gear 10, left centering rod 3 and right centering rod 4 penetrate in housing 7, left tooth bar 5 and right tooth bar position 6 are in housing 7, the tooth mouth corresponding matching of described gear 10 and left tooth bar 5 and right tooth bar 6.
